Cloudflare là gì? Vì sao bạn nên sử dụng cho trang web?

hướng dẫn sử dụng Cloudflare

Cloudflare là gì?

Cloudflare là một dịch vụ cung cấp các tính năng bảo mật và tăng hiệu suất cho trang web bằng hệ thống các máy chủ được đặt khắp thế giới. Nó hoạt động như một máy chủ trung gian giữa khách truy cập và hosting, giúp truyền tải dữ liệu nhanh hơn và ngăn chặn các truy cập độc hại. Khi bạn truy cập vào trang web đó, bạn sẽ được chuyển đến một trong các máy chủ của Cloudflare thay vì máy chủ thực sự của trang web.

Cloudflare hoạt động như thế nào?

Để có thể giải thích được cách hoạt của Cloudflare, trước tiên bạn cần phải hiểu cách mà các trang web hoạt động.

Lấy ví dụ: trang web kiem-tien.com được phục vụ bởi máy chủ có địa chỉ IP là 81.02.30.20. Khi bạn gõ “kiem-tien.com” vào trình duyệt để truy cập vào trang web, trình duyệt sẽ gửi yêu cầu đến DNS (Domain name – hệ thống phân giải tên miền) và nhận được kết quả là địa chỉ IP 81.02.30.20, đó là cách để bạn có thể truy cập được trang web.

trang web không dùng cloudflare

Máy chủ của Cloudflare được đặt ở khắp mọi nơi trên thế giới. Nếu trang web của bạn sử dụng dịch vụ của Cloudflare, Cloudflare sẽ là máy chủ trung gian giúp truyền tải dữ liệu nhanh hơn đến với người dùng. Đặt biệt khi bạn sử dụng hosting/VPS được cung cấp tại Mỹ.

Cloudflare hoạt động hoàn toàn bình thường khi trang web WordPress của bạn sử dụng plugin tối ưu hóa như Autoptimize và plugin tạo cache.

Ngoài ra, Cloudflare có thể lọc được tất cả các truy cập được xác định là hành động hack, DDOS, và các bad bots (các máy chủ truy cập để thu thập thông tin trang web làm cho trang web của bạn quá tải). Nó chỉ cho người dùng bình thường và các máy tìm kiếm như Google, Bing được phép truy cập.

trang web sử dụng cloudflare

Những lợi ích từ việc sử dụng Cloudflare

Ngăn ngừa tấn công Brute-force, DDOS, Hack

cloudflare kiểm tra trình duyệt người dùng

Cloudflare kiểm tra trình duyệt người dùng trước khi cho phép truy cập

Ngoài các thiết lập bảo mật cho WordPress, sử dụng Cloudflare giúp lọc hầu hết các cuộc tấn công DDOS, SQL injection, Brute-Force, Spam bình luận ngay tại máy chủ của nó mà không cho truy cập vào máy chủ của bạn. Việc này sẽ giúp cho trang web của bạn được an toàn.

Di chuyển Hosting mà không cần đợi DNS cập nhật

Bình thường nếu không sử dụng Cloudflare, khi bạn di chuyển sang hosting mới và cập nhật nameserver mới, thời gian chờ đợi thường mất khoảng 1 ngày, có khi là 2 ngày để hệ thống DNS cập nhật lại hoàn toàn. Lúc đó trang web của bạn mới có thể được truy cập tại hosting mới.

Nhưng khi bạn sử dụng dịch vụ Cloudflare, bạn không cần phải chờ đợi. Vì Cloudflare là máy chủ DNS trung gian, nó sẽ trỏ đến IP mới ngay lập tức. Việc của bạn chỉ cần thay đổi IP máy chủ cũ thành IP mới trong trang quản trị của Cloudflare.

Dịch vụ CDN miễn phí

máy chủ của Cloudflare trên thế giới

Cloudflare có hệ thống máy chủ được đặt rất nhiều nơi trên thế giới để có thể phục vụ người dùng ở gần đó, giúp tăng tốc khi truy cập trang web. Nó lưu trữ cache trang web của bạn, bao gồm hình ảnh, JS, CSS, sẵn sàng phục vụ khi người dùng gần đó truy cập. Dịch vụ này đăc biệt tốt nếu bạn đang sử dụng hosting ở nước ngoài.

Tiết kiệm băng thông

Với việc lọc ra các truy cập độc hại, và sử dụng cache để phục vụ cho người dùng, bạn sẽ tiết kiệm được rất nhiều băng thông. Các trang web của mình hiện tại tiết kiệm được khoảng 70% băng thông so với khi không dùng Cloudflare.

SSL (https) miễn phí

Kể từ khi Google thông báo SSL ảnh hưởng đến SEO thì việc cài đặt SSL cho website càng trở nên cấp thiết. Cloudflare đã cung cấp giải pháp SSL miễn phí cho tất cả các website sử dụng dịch vụ của họ. Nếu bạn đang dùng Cloudflare thì chỉ cần vào trang quản trị Cloudflare và bật chức năng SSL.

Vẫn có thể truy cập trang web khi Hosting/VPS không hoạt động

Chức năng Always Online của Cloudflare sẽ giúp cho trang web của bạn vẫn có thể truy cập trong khi Hosting/VPS không hoạt động. Lúc này Cloudflare sẽ dùng cache đã lưu trước đó trong máy chủ để phục vụ người dùng.

Hướng dẫn sử dụng Cloudflare cho trang web

 

Sau nhiều năm sử dụng Cloudflare, mình khuyên tất cả mọi người đang có trang web hãy sử dụng dịch vụ này. Tất cả dịch vụ đều tốt mà lại miễn phí. Nó có lợi cho SEO On-page bằng việc tăng tốc trang web và sử dụng SSL. Nếu có điều kiện, bạn hãy sử dụng dịch vụ có phí của nó với nhiều chức năng nâng cao.

Nếu bạn đang dùng Cloudflare mà thấy có lợi ích khác nữa thì hãy để lại bình luận nhé!